Advice Worker
Job description
The post-holder will be a member of the Advice Worker team. As an Advice Worker you offer a criminal injuries compensation service to assist victims of violent crime apply for compensation. Your primary responsibilities will be the effective operation, support and case management of applicants applying to the scheme; supporting victims to complete Victim Personal Statements and for the promotion of these and other relevant Victim Support services.
Responsibilities
- Follow the organisational procedures and statutory requirements of the compensation process ensuring consistency and effectiveness of delivery in line with the defined standard of service as agreed with the Department of Justice.
- Achieve standards of performance and performance targets in line with Conditions of Grant funding laid down by the Department of Justice.
- Provide support and guidance to staff and volunteers, when necessary, regarding compensation queries at all stages of the process. Including participation in training sessions when possible.

Skills and Qualifications
Essential Skills
- Achieved A level standard and a minimum of 2 years’ experience in a similar role as an Advice/Advocacy worker or related field or
- A minimum of 5 years’ experience in a in a similar role as an Advice/Advocacy worker or related field.

Desirable Skills
- Sound knowledge of the Northern Ireland Criminal Justice sector.
- Knowledge of the Northern Ireland Criminal Injuries Compensation Scheme would be advantageous.
- Knowledge of the Victim Support NI or the issues affecting Victims of Crime in Northern Ireland would be advantageous.
- Experience of Social Security/Welfare or Advice Tribunal representation.
